Transaction b3c7864bd3e6135e117858a36f640d53bb1779dd86ffa15e2a4deaf01e52ad2a
1 Input
1 Output
-
b3c7864bd3e6135e117858a36f640d53bb1779dd86ffa15e2a4deaf01e52ad2a:0
- value
- 12514465
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c88ee86e120655782b53300036b7ba9dd95c73a OP_EQUAL
- address
- 3LLVorvodXvJkF15y55Bt27wARRJprrtzv